PEOPLE v. McDAVIS


97 A.D.2d 302 (1983)

The People of the State of New York, Respondent, v. Darryl McDavis, Appellant

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Fourth Department.

December 16, 1983


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Rose H. Sconiers (Joseph Mistrett of counsel), for appellant.

Richard J. Arcara (Louis Haremski of counsel), for respondent.

HANCOCK, JR., J. P., CALLAHAN, DENMAN and MOULE, JJ., concur.


BOOMER, J.

During the course of an attempted rape, the defendant stabbed the victim six times in the chest and breast and twice in the abdomen. After a jury trial, the defendant was convicted of attempt to commit murder in the second degree, two counts of assault in the first degree, attempt to commit rape in the first degree, and criminal possession of a weapon.
